Emile Philippe, student of Wiese, a pair of Celtic revival ormolu and champleve enamelled vases, circa 1870s, twin handled inverse baluster form, the handles pierced and chased with knotted foliate scrolls, the bodies with panels of Celtic knots in blue, white and red, 21.5cm high (2) Please note that condition reports are not printed in the catalogue or online, however we are happy to provide them when requested subject to our terms and conditions of sale.
